Last Updated: Sep 29, 2025 (UTC)Zuari Industries: Mixed Signals in September
Detailed Analysis
- On September 26, 2025, Zuari Industries reported Q1 FY26 results showing a 14.07% increase in total income to ₹257.46 crore, but revenue from operations actually decreased to ₹210.3 crore compared to ₹214.5 crore in Q1 FY25. The company posted a profit after tax of ₹0.05 crore, a significant improvement from the ₹33.35 crore loss in the same quarter last year, though consolidated results showed a loss of Rs -0.48 crore. This mixed performance highlights ongoing operational adjustments.
- Despite the improved profitability, Zuari Industries removed its final dividend on September 16, 2025, with the last dividend date being September 17, 2025, and a yield of 0.34%. This decision may disappoint income-focused investors, even with the positive earnings turnaround.
- The company continues to focus on ethanol diversification, with the 180 KLPD grain-based ethanol plant in Uttar Pradesh reaching 76% completion as of September 2025 and still expected to begin operations by September 2025. This plant represents a key growth initiative for the company.
- As of March 2025, Zuari Industries’ debt increased to ₹25.1 billion, up from ₹23.8 billion a year prior, with net debt around ₹18.2 billion. Concerns remain regarding a weak interest cover of 0.079 times and a high net debt to EBITDA ratio of 36.3, indicating significant financial leverage.
- An analyst, Palak Jain, issued a "strong buy" signal on September 25, 2025, citing a symmetrical triangle breakout and strong RSI momentum, with target prices ranging from ₹388 to ₹421. However, on September 26, 2025, the stock experienced a drop, closing at 380.90 (-5.73%) on the BSE and 381.70 (-5.50%) on the NSE.
- Shareholders approved key proposals at the 57th AGM on September 24, 2025, including the re-appointment of statutory auditors and the appointment of a secretarial auditor for five years. They also approved shifting the registered office from Goa to Haryana, subject to approvals.
- The trading window for Designated Persons closed on October 1, 2025, ahead of the Q2 FY26 earnings announcement, indicating an upcoming financial report.
